Which Specifications Should You Consider When Choosing a Replacement Adapter?

When choosing a replacement adapter for your HTC Vive base station, consider the following specifications:

  • Voltage Rating: The adapter should match the voltage requirements of the original unit, typically around 12V for HTC Vive base stations.
  • Current Rating: Ensure the adapter can provide sufficient current output, often at least 1.5A or higher, to maintain performance without overheating.
  • Connector Type: The connector must be compatible with the HTC Vive base station, usually a barrel connector, so verify the size and polarity to avoid damage.
  • Power Efficiency: Look for adapters with high efficiency ratings to minimize energy waste and prevent overheating during use.
  • Safety Certifications: Choose adapters that are certified by recognized safety standards, such as UL or CE, indicating they have been tested for safety and reliability.

The voltage rating is crucial as using an adapter with the wrong voltage can lead to malfunction or damage. For HTC Vive base stations, a voltage of 12V is standard, so confirming this specification ensures compatibility.

The current rating indicates how much power the adapter can deliver. If the adapter provides insufficient current, it may not operate the base station effectively, potentially leading to performance issues such as instability or failure to power on.

Connector type is essential because even if the voltage and current ratings are correct, an incompatible connector can prevent the adapter from connecting properly. The barrel connector’s size and polarity must match what the HTC Vive requires to function safely.

Power efficiency is an important consideration since high-efficiency adapters convert more input power into usable output, reducing energy waste. This not only helps in saving on electricity bills but also contributes to longevity, as less heat is generated during operation.

Finally, safety certifications provide assurance that the adapter adheres to industry standards for performance and safety. Choosing a certified adapter minimizes the risks associated with electrical faults and ensures reliable operation over time.

What Are Common Signs of a Failing Base Station AC Adapter?

Common signs of a failing base station AC adapter include:

  • Intermittent Power Supply: The adapter may not consistently provide power to the base station, causing it to turn on and off unexpectedly.
  • Unusual Heat Production: If the adapter becomes excessively hot during operation, it could indicate internal failure or overheating issues.
  • No Power Indicator Light: A lack of indicator lights on the adapter or base station suggests that it is not functioning correctly.
  • Frayed Cables or Damage: Visible wear and tear on the power cable can lead to poor connectivity and eventual failure of the adapter.
  • Inconsistent Charging: If the adapter does not charge the base station properly or shows slow charging times, it may be nearing the end of its lifespan.

The intermittent power supply can disrupt the performance of your HTC Vive setup, making it challenging to maintain an immersive experience. If you notice that your base station is turning off without warning, it may be time to consider a replacement.

Unusual heat production is a critical sign that something is wrong. A functioning adapter should remain relatively cool during use, so if it becomes hot to the touch, it could be at risk of failure, which may also pose a fire hazard.

A lack of power indicator lights usually means that the adapter is not supplying power. This could be due to an internal fault, which prevents it from functioning properly, indicating the need for replacement.

Frayed cables or physical damage can lead to poor connectivity between the adapter and the base station. If you notice any visible signs of wear, it’s essential to replace the adapter to avoid potential damage to your equipment.

Inconsistent charging can manifest as slow charging times or the base station not charging at all. This issue often indicates that the adapter’s efficiency has diminished, warranting a replacement to restore optimal performance.

What Troubleshooting Steps Can You Take if Your Replacement Adapter Isn’t Working?

If your replacement adapter for the HTC Vive base station isn’t functioning, consider the following troubleshooting steps:

  • Check Compatibility: Ensure that the replacement adapter is compatible with the HTC Vive base station. Different models may require specific voltage and amperage specifications, and using an incompatible adapter could prevent proper operation.
  • Inspect Connections: Examine all connections between the adapter, base station, and power source. Loose or damaged cables can interrupt power delivery, so make sure all plugs are securely fitted and free from wear and tear.
  • Power Source Verification: Test the power outlet where the adapter is plugged in. Sometimes, the issue may stem from a faulty outlet or power strip. Plug the adapter into a different outlet to rule out this possibility.
  • Reset the Base Station: Perform a reset on the base station. Unplug the adapter and wait for about 30 seconds before plugging it back in. This can help clear any temporary issues and allow the base station to detect the power supply correctly.
  • Check for Firmware Updates: Ensure that the base station’s firmware is up to date. Sometimes, outdated firmware can cause compatibility issues with new hardware. Visit the manufacturer’s website or use the HTC Vive software to check for updates.
  • Test with Another Adapter: If possible, test the base station with another working adapter. This can help determine if the problem lies with the replacement adapter itself or with the base station.
  • Seek Professional Help: If none of the above steps resolve the issue, consider reaching out to customer support or a professional repair service. They can provide specific diagnostics and solutions tailored to your situation.
